Expand Your Understanding of Medical Terms
Keeping up with the new terminology in the medical field is important for career development and advancement. This Certificate Program covers a wide variety of medical vocabulary related to: diseases, symptoms, investigations/lab testing, treatment, examination, and prevention. The program will also address language related to bodily parts and functions.
You will learn to:
- Become familiar with western medical terminology
- Learn about the parts and functions of the body
- Increase your understanding of systems, diseases, and symptoms
- Discover more about Infections and Psychiatric disorders
- Explore diseases associated with the nervous system

Who Should Attend: Health care professionals who speak English as a Second Language, and who are pursuing or planning to pursue a degree in a field related to medicine.
Pre-requisite: This course is designed for upper-intermediate to advanced level English speakers.
Instructor: Karen Anne Hayes, M.A., Teaching English as a Second Language; M.S., Traditional Oriental Medicine. Click on the “I” next to the section above to get full instructor bio.
Required Materials: Textbook, Professional English in Use-Medicine, Eric Glendinning and Ron Howard
